Audiology department awards AFA Student Excellence Endowed Scholarships

A.T. Still University’s audiology program recently awarded its annual Audiology Foundation of America Student Excellence Endowed Scholarship to two outstanding residential students. Each award recipient received a $1,000 scholarship. Students were selected based on their clinical skills, academic standing, and demonstrated commitment to professional and community service. Dr. Farris receives Special Olympics’ Golisano Health Leadership Award

Jim Farris, PT, PhD, chair of physical therapy at A.T. StillUniversity’s Arizona School of Health Sciences (ATSU-ASHS), was honored with the 2018 Special Olympics’ Golisano Health Leadership Award.
